Early Action and Responsiveness Lifts Youth Minds Act

The EARLY Minds Act amends the Public Health Service Act to expand prevention and early intervention services under the Block Grants for Community Mental Health Services program, specifically targeting youth mental health.

Key Points

  • 1Adds requirement for states to describe evidence-based prevention and early intervention strategies in their state plans
  • 2Allows states to use up to 5% of their block grant funds for prevention and early intervention services
  • 3Requires biennial reporting to Congress on state activities, outcomes, and demographics
  • 4Focuses on children and adolescents regardless of serious mental illness diagnosis
  • 5Mandates reporting on reduced delays in accessing mental health care
  • 6Tracks outcomes related to reduced severity of mental health conditions
